96 percent of step 3,800 someone employed by the brand new Crepes & Waffles eatery chain was feminine

BOGOTA (Thomson Reuters Basis) – On dish washers searching dishes throughout the kitchen area to your make turning pancakes and cashier ringing in the transform, there is one thing that unites the employees at this cafe from inside the Colombia’s capital.

Indeed, 96 percent of one’s step 3,800 anybody employed by the newest Crepes & Waffles cafe strings within the Colombia and you may across Latin The united states was female. Not only are they female, however, many of these was solitary moms and dads, and frequently the only real breadwinners in their family.

That have an extremely female team was not a portion of the 1st business plan, told you Beatriz Fernandez, whom depending Crepes & Waffles as the a little French-determined creperie when you look at the Bogota 34 years ago together with her today husband, Eduardo Macias.

But usually, it has got proven to be perfect for team and an excellent way of training women from impoverishment while assaulting Colombia’s manly people, she told you.

“Ladies are the new system from changes, brand new central source out-of a family. Colombia is actually a secure of women. These are typically the ones who care for the students, capture them to college, and gives in their mind,” Fernandez informed Thomson Reuters Base since people queued for a table.

“So feminine provide alot more commitment to the job while they have a greater sense of obligation because of their family, which have both around five people.”

This new strings, that has been charged given that a model of ladies financial empowerment in the individual market inside the Latin The usa from the Colombia’s Rosario School, and therefore approved its owners organization management of the season award into the 2008, features 34 food overseas, and in the Brazil, Panama, Mexico, Chile, Venezuela and you will Spain.

The only guy located working at any Crepes & Waffles cafe ‘s the cover protect in the doorway. Only on the Venezuelan funding Caracas, really does the company use some male waiters since it is viewed as as well risky for women to depart works later at night, Fernandez said.

During the Colombia, conventional insights have it that ladies tend to be reduced corrupt than simply guys. Fernandez could not say if that try really the case.

“But I could point out that a female manages her business more a man does due to the fact there clearly was even more at stake to own their particular, ” Fernandez said. “Whenever a lady ‘s the best breadwinner having their unique children, she’s going to be reluctant in advance of performing things foolish which could rating their unique sacked.”

Un Female, the fresh You.Letter. women’s institution, says giving female work and much more generating fuel enhances gender equivalence and helps to battle poverty as women spend more of its wages on their families than simply dudes manage, which often function their children are better provided and knowledgeable.

With regards to the Globe Lender, over 70 million feamales in Latin The united states possess joined this new personnel previously two decades, reducing high poverty in your community by the 30 percent about past years.

“Machismo crushes women. It creates a woman become she actually is a control and you may an object,” told you Fernandez. “By giving feminine perform provide them monetary balances and you may an excellent most useful upcoming for their students.”

Her company shines in the a country in which the unemployment rate during the 2013 getting ladies aged around twenty eight was 21.six %, nearly double the unemployment price having more youthful guys.

From inside the Colombia, it is really not strange to have companies to give female perform according to the way they browse and ignore feminine old over forty. It indicates ladies are more likely than men to get rid of upwards into the reasonable-wage perform about everyday cost savings, United nations Feminine claims.

“We don’t require people variety of experience to locate a career at the Crepes. We don’t discriminate by many years, physical appearance or if some body are illiterate,” Fernandez said.

“Once we see a curriculum vitae, i ask our selves or no almost every other business manage hire all of them. If in case maybe not, following we shall. We get a hold of intelligence in the center, a willingness to your workplace and also to change.”

Including an opening paycheck of $390 – to 10 % greater than minimal wage – employees deserve private health care once per year with the providers, access to reasonable-desire loans and you may discounts strategies to find automatic washers, house and you may autos.

The business and runs a free of charge arts hub in which staff can get pilates and moving categories and you may workshops for you to remain college students out of medicines.

Diana Rivadeneira become operating from the Crepes & Waffles because a dish washer when she is actually 22 and a good single mother. Eleven age with the, she today handles among the eatery twigs.

“Crepes is actually a beneficial female’s business you to knows just what it’s need to be mother. I’m conscious you to instead of a beneficial university degree being more 30, basically went in search of a career in other places I’d not be considering an excellent managerial article while the brand of money I secure now,” said Rivadeneira, since the she along with her party from 43 feminine seated as a result of lunch, if you’re hearing Fernandez bring her day-after-day morning pep talk to personnel on a cellular phone.
